You can even get a full glass of beer at a cocktail lounge." -Raymond Chandler, Red Wind Los Angeles. The kind of city where anything that can happen, does happen. And everything that does happen, right and wrong, seems to belong here-it couldn't happen anywhere else. There's an air of beauty and shame here, a twisted knot of the city's glory and its sins bound tight together-unlike the comparatively ancient New York, say, L.A.'s sins are still recent, the wounds still scabbed and unhealed across its golden-hued, suntanned skin. Missing neighborhoods, missing gangs, missing loves, missing lives. In this city, turn any corner, walk down any mean street, and you'll find a mystery, cruel and enticing and magic and heartbreaking, waiting for you there. And that's just one of the topics touched upon between our host and today's guest, Jordan Harper, whose epic, feature-length conversation rumbles from such topic's as L.A. crime, race-based prison gangs, the history of Los Angeles land use and abuse, noir's unique relationship to L.A., James Ellroy, adapting difficult novels, Jordan's wrestling with the PTA oeuvre, and much, much more (including where to find the best BBQ in Missouri). About the Guest - JORDAN HARPER Jordan Harper is the Edgar Award-winning author of the incredible SHE RIDES SHOTGUN and LOVE AND OTHER WOUNDS. He is also a television writer and producer, and wrote/developed the late, great, and unreleased L.A CONFIDENTIAL TV series, which had a pilot so perfect that its demise is final, conclusive proof of God's absence. ONE HEAT MINUTE PRODUCTIONS began with film journalist Blake Howard examining Michael Mann's 1995 crime opus HEAT chronologically, in 60-second increments, in the aptly titled "One HEAT Minute." The finale featured the legendary mastermind director, screenwriter and producer behind the film Michael Mann. The show continues with: MIAMI NICE is a "Modern Mann" campfire podcast that pours over every loveable morsel of Michael Mann's misunderstood masterpiece Miami Vice (2006). The show's expanding catalogue frequently strays into the world of other contemporary Mann productions like Collateral (Collateral Confessions), Tokyo Vice (Tokyo Nice) and Blackhat.
